Band 7+: Financial education should be a mandatory component of the school program. To what extent do you agree or disagree with this statement?

Note: Both the topic and the essay were created by one of our users.

It is true that financial knowledge is of great importance to individuals’ wealth. It is argued that money management should be a compulsory subject at schools to equip students with such knowledge. Although this skill is truly crucial to one’s future financial security, I believe that making it mandatory is not optimal for students’ overall development.

Admittedly, money management is a crucial skill for people to improve their financial situation. This is because understanding financial principles enables individuals to allocate their income more effectively, resulting in better-informed financial decisions. As a result, they can manage their debt, establish necessary savings and explore investment opportunities to increase their personal wealth. In fact, people without financial knowledge are more likely to be in heavy debt due to their poor financial decisions, such as overspending or engaging in risky investment.

However, I contend that making financial education a mandatory part of school curriculum may be detrimental to students in terms of other aspects. First, the current curriculum is heavy enough to burden students with a considerable amount of schoolwork, therefore, adding another compulsory subject will not only cause extra stress and workload but also reduce their recreational time. To illustrate, in Vietnam, if financial literacy were introduced, students would have to take 14 compulsory subjects at a time, which could negatively affect their overall well-being and academic performance of other important subjects. Furthermore, while it is directly linked to personal wealth, it is not as important to students’ future success as their professional development, particularly if they have no interest in pursuing a career that requires such knowledge. For example, students who desire to become artists or doctors may have to divert their valuable time from their specialized training to acquire money skills – skills they can develop later in life when they are independent. For these students, mandating financial literacy prevents them from focusing on their true passion.

In conclusion, while financial education could enable individuals to manage their money more effectively, it is not advisable to force all students at school levels to take it.
